ADVERTISING ON THIS SITE

BIN/IIN: 420796

BIN/IIN 420796
Brand VISA
Type DEBIT
Category PREPAID ELECTRON
Bank BANQUE INVIK, S.A.
Country Luxembourg
Country Short LU